A diagonal condition is defined which internally characterises those Cauchy spaces which have topological completions. The T2 diagonal Cauchy spaces allow both a finest and a coarsest T2 diagonal completion. The former is a completion functor, while the latter preserves uniformisability and has an extension property relative to θ-continuous maps.
